Viscoelasticity can also be a cool time period. It can be damaged down into the phrases viscous (thick, sticky, gummy) and elastic (expandable, flexible, stretchy). If a substance is viscous, it will develop into deformed, and stay deformed, when an outside pressure manipulates it. Think about compressing a piece of clay along with your fist. The clay will flatten and remain flattened. If a substance is elastic it'll deform when manipulated by an out of doors pressure but snap again into its unique form when the surface force is removed (consider pulling and releasing a rubber band). Decreasing fascial restrictions and adhesions in mushy tissue in order that functionally separate constructions don’t stick together is usually a main goal of deep-tissue therapeutic massage. As people age, or due to habitual motion patterns, damage, lack of motion, poor postural habits, or mushy-tissue stress, collagen fibers begin to pack extra tightly collectively, increasing hydrogen bonding between the fibers.


Having flat feet or a flatfoot situation occurs when one or each ft have minimum or lack an arch. Patients with this deformity press the pads of their feet into the ground once they stand. Often, the arch shouldn't be seen in the foot, but it could appear when they elevate the foot. Orthotics may improve gait patterns and proper abnormal movement patterns caused by foot deformities in adults. They help cut back extreme motion, guarantee proper weight distribution, and promote extra environment friendly motion. Some orthotic gadgets are additionally designed with shock-absorbing properties. They can assist reduce influence forces that include strolling or bodily actions. Some benefits can be felt immediately, but common sessions are advisable for long-term enchancment. What's The aim of Deep Tissue Massage? Deep tissue massage is a specialized therapeutic massage technique that focuses on relieving tension within the deeper layers of your muscle tissue, fascia (the connective tissue that surrounds muscles), and tendons. Not like a stress-free Swedish therapeutic massage, deep tissue massage utilizes slower, extra forceful strokes and direct pressure to target particular areas of chronic tightness and pain.
